Euro24 : Germany escapes with last minute equaliser vs Switzerland, Hungary last minute goal breaks Scottish hearts

 



2 late goals were the highlights of the final two group A clashes as Germany escapes defeat with a  last minute equaliser & Hungary broke Scottish hearts with a last second winner. 

**Germany Secures Group A Top Spot with Late Equalizer Against Switzerland at Euro 2024**


Germany salvaged a 1-1 draw against Switzerland in Euro 2024 thanks to Niclas Fullkrug's stoppage-time goal, securing the top position in Group A for the hosts.


Dan Ndoye of Bologna appeared to score the match-winner for Switzerland with a stunning volley past Manuel Neuer from Remo Freuler’s exquisite first-half cross.


Despite Switzerland's robust defense, Germany persisted and equalized in the 92nd minute. Substitute David Raum's cross found Fullkrug, who headed the ball past Yann Sommer.


With this draw, Germany tops Group A and will face the runner-up from England’s group in the last 16. Switzerland will play against the second-placed team from Group B, which could be Albania, Italy, or Croatia.


In the match at Frankfurt’s Waldstadion, Germany dominated possession, but Switzerland posed a continuous threat on the counter-attack, with key contributions from Ndoye, Breel Embolo, and substitute Ruben Vargas.


Germany had several near-misses, including a header from Kai Havertz that hit the crossbar and efforts from Leroy Sane, before Fullkrug's goal secured the draw and ensured Germany edged Switzerland for the group's top spot.


**Hungary Defeats Scotland with Dramatic Last-Minute Goal**


Hungary's stoppage-time goal sealed a 1-0 victory over Scotland at Euro 2024, ending Scotland's dreams of reaching the knockout stages for the first time.


Kevin Csoboth, a late substitute, scored his first international goal in the 110th minute, placing Hungary third in Group A, behind Germany and Switzerland.


Hungary now anxiously awaits confirmation of whether their three points will be enough to progress to the round of 16 as one of the four best third-place teams, which will be determined after the final round of group games on Wednesday.


Scotland, finishing last in the group with one point from a draw against Switzerland, has been eliminated. They suffered a heavy 5-1 defeat to Germany in their Euro 2024 opener.


Despite controlling possession, Scotland struggled to penetrate Hungary’s defense. Both goalkeepers made crucial saves in a chaotic stoppage time before Csoboth's decisive goal. He started the counterattack, connected with an unmarked Roland Sallai, and finished with a near-post shot, sparking wild celebrations among Hungary's players and fans.


The match was marred by a serious injury to Hungary’s Barnabas Varga. The 29-year-old striker was hospitalized in stable condition after a collision with Scotland goalkeeper Angus Gunn. Varga's head struck Gunn's trailing arm as the goalkeeper punched the ball away. Medics quickly brought a stretcher onto the field, and Varga was carried off as his teammates urged for faster assistance.
